Tax

Our tax department has significant experience in advising clients in all areas of Swiss direct and indirect taxation, both at cantonal and federal levels.

We assist corporate clients in general tax planning, providing solutions related to mergers and acquisitions, corporate reorganizations and relocations, joint ventures, business sales and financial structuring.

We advise entrepreneurs in the structuring of their holdings and companies on tax efficient remuneration of personnel, including employee incentive schemes. The tax practice is also involved in setting up and advising charitable foundations.

We seek to offer to our corporate clients, to their owners or their key employees simple and efficient solutions.

We also assist private individuals in all the questions relating to their relocation and their global and estate tax planning.

Thanks to the full integration of our firm, our tax planning is well integrated in our clients' overall business and legal strategy.

We are often involved in international transactions and are used to working together with a network of carefully selected foreign correspondents.

Our solutions are carefully studied and, whenever needed, are secured by binding tax rulings issued by the relevant federal and/or cantonal tax authorities with whom we are in frequent contact.

We ensure that we stay ahead of the numerous and constant developments in this area of law and of the administration's practice and are involved in various organizations monitoring and discussing such developments.
